8 THE STOOP is a midsized extended detached house of 111m², built sometime between 2003 and 2006, which could now be worth an estimated £475,168. It was last sold for £450,000 in April 2023, which was around 15% above the average April 2023 detached price in the Coventry local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was May 2022,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

8 THE STOOP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Coventry local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 8 THE STOOP sales from April 2003 and April 2023 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the April 2003 sale was for 12%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 12% above the HPI over time, until the April 2023 sale, where it rises to 15%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 15% above the HPI.

What might 8 THE STOOP be worth now?

8 THE STOOP might now be worth an estimated £475,168.

This is based on house price inflation of 5.6%, between April 2023 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Coventry local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 5.6%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 8 THE STOOP of £450,000 on 3rd April 2023. For the value to have increased from £450,000 to £475,168 over the two years and two months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 8 THE STOOP has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Coventry local authority area.
  • The April 2023 sale price of £450,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 8 THE STOOP has not materially changed since April 2023.
